### Runbook: Validator plugin review (Sievewright)

All data validators in Sievewright load via the plugin registry at startup. Reviewers should confirm each new plugin declares its schema version, passes the conformance suite, and avoids network calls in the `validate()` path. Plugins failing conformance are quarantined automatically, not rejected, so a missed check can silently degrade coverage. Merge only after the registry dry-run log is attached. Plugin authoring standards and the conformance suite docs live at the page below.

dashboard of yahaf-kajep = https://jira.zemvarsys.internal/display/projects/browse/browse/a08b

Bucketeer assigns A/B variants at request time. Assignments are deterministic: same user, same experiment, same bucket. Never cache assignments client-side past 24h. If the assignment endpoint 503s, fall back to control — do not retry in a loop. Health checks live under /internal/status. To query the assignment service directly from staging, authenticate with the key below.

service key, tadup-tahog: zpat7_wB1tnEL

Handover note — survey instruments crate

Pria, leaving this for you before my leave. The crate of Dunmere survey instruments goes back to the Caldwell field office on Friday; the calibration certificates are in the sleeve taped inside the lid. Records team should photocopy the certificates before the crate is sealed. Courier collects from the side entrance at midday, and the hand-over must follow this instruction.

handover note for yagef-bagep: the drudor pelius courier leaves the kasdor zorvan norir ledger at gate 8016 under passcode 755406

## Ticket: Deep-Link Routing Fix — Needs Sign-Off

Scope: the Wrenfold mobile app mishandles deep links that include query params, dropping users on the home screen instead of the target view. Fix the router in `nav/linkmap` to parse params before route matching. Do not touch the universal-link manifest — that's a separate release train. Add tests for malformed links and expired share tokens. Builds go through the Tidepool CI lane as usual. Before merge, this ticket requires sign-off from the person named below.

account owner for bawip-tahag: Raleth Quenok